Travel Tips

I learned most of these tips from my sis-in-law Susy who’s a travel junkie. lol

  1. Bring a sound machine. This is perfect if you don’t want to hear other people or noise in the hotel room. I hate that the walls are so thin you can hear everything. Also sometimes it’s too quiet and this too can be strange for my ears.
  2. Bring febreze and Lysol spray and wipes (not all hotels are clean even if they are rated 4 stars. Some hotels that are rated 3 are in better condition.)
  3. Keep disinfectant and wipes in your purse. If you are a parent you understand that kids get messy.
  4. Always check the sheets and bed. Make sure they are clean. One of my pet peeves is unclean sheets and pillows. To all hotels “YOU HAVE ONE JOB TO DO! MAKE SURE YOU CLEAN THE SHEETS AND PILLOWS AND BATHROOMS”
  5. Bring a diffuser if you don’t like the smell of hotels & Febreze.
  6. Buy a cooler that plugs in your car that way you have water and beverages any time you need and they stay cold.
  7. A great item to have for the beach is a buggy to carry all your things. My sis-in-law had one. Love this idea!
  8. If you are crossing the border make sure you have American change because they have tolls and you need to pay.
  9. Keep your passports with you at all times while you travel around the USA. Don’t leave them in the hotel because if you are stopped by authorities they will ask for your passports.
  10. If you are travelling long distance make sure you plan and book a hotel half way point. It makes things easier for the driver.
  11. My sister in law Susy used Hotels.com to book the hotels. I download the app and it gives you great options. You can actually get a free hotel after a certain amount of bookings.
  12. I used google maps a lot while I travelled and it offers a lot of places to eat and discover. I even added my own reviews which is pretty cool.
  13. Make sure you contact your phone provider if you are driving out of range. You can get charged so much if you don’t. I’m with Bell and we called them right away and they changed our plan so that we were able to use our phone freely.
  14. Pack some snacks for the journey.

Carrot Quinoa Ginger Soup – RECIPE

bestdayblogger blogpost header

3356

Ingredients and Instuctions

In a pot add:

8 Cups Water

2 Cups of chopped up Carrots

1  Allspice ball

3 Cloves of Garlic

1 Whole yellow onion

1 tsp salt

1/4 tsp black pepper

1 Vegetable or Chicken bouillon cube

1 tbs Olive Oil

1 tbs Paprika (not spicy)

1 tsp onion powder

1tsp garlic powder

1tsp ginger powder

  1. Boil for 35 min on medium heat and then remove the allspice ball.
  2. I use my hand blender and pureed the ingredients.  I leave some chunks of carrot.
  3. I then add 1 Cup of Quinoa and boil for 15 min.
  4. Take  it off the heat and cover for 5 -10 min and enjoy!

3360


 

Goes really well with dried crunchy toast or bread.
